China’s largest new energy vehicle (NEV) manufacturer, BYD Company, has entered into a new partnership with Xiaoju Charging, the EV charging subsidiary of Chuxing Technology Company, to jointly build an intelligent, rapid charging network in the country using their latest charging technologies.

Earlier this year, BYD unveiled its new “Megawatt Flash Charging” technology, which can provide battery electric vehicles (BEVs) with a driving range of up to 400 km with just a five-minute charge.

The two companies are working together to build a network of 10,000 Megawatt Flash Charging stations over the next three years, with the aim of providing a high-quality, rapid charging service for their customers, including private car owners, ride-hailing drivers, logistics operators, and public transport vehicles. Construction of the first charging station is already underway in Nanchang, Jiangxi province.

Xiaoju Charging recently announced that it planned to invest CNY 100 million this year to help charging site operators upgrade their equipment, allowing them to improve their charging services and customer experience. The upgrades include “intelligent acceleration”, smart maintenance, and advanced safety features.
